The Founders argued that the Electoral College would prevent incompetent persons from becoming president. In the Federalist Papers, Alexander Hamilton asserted that

The process of election affords a moral certainty, that the office of President will never fall to the lot of any man who is not in an eminent degree endowed with the requisite qualifications.

Clearly, the Founders were, as my old boss used to say, “in error.”
